0

I want to post a form with HTML

<form method="POST" enctype="multipart/form-data">
    {% csrf_token %}

    // some inputs
</form>

views.py

def request_create(request):
    context = {}
    return render(
      request, template_name="requestz/request_form.html", context=context
    )

My middlewares are these

MIDDLEWARE = [
    "django.middleware.security.SecurityMiddleware",
    "django.contrib.sessions.middleware.SessionMiddleware",
    "django.middleware.common.CommonMiddleware",
    "django.middleware.csrf.CsrfViewMiddleware",
    "django.contrib.auth.middleware.AuthenticationMiddleware",
    "django.middleware.clickjacking.XFrameOptionsMiddleware",
]

When I try to post a form, it is showing the following error

Forbidden (403) CSRF verification failed. Request aborted.

When I go back from error and submit the form again it works!

maca2.0
  • 93
  • 7

0 Answers0